Course Details
• Advanced Political Ideologies: This unit covers the in-depth study of various political ideologies that have shaped the world, such as liberalism, conservatism, socialism, fascism, and communism.
• Global Governance: This unit explores the various institutions and mechanisms that govern the global community, including the United Nations, the World Bank, and the International Monetary Fund.
• Human Rights and International Law: This unit delves into the international laws and conventions that protect human rights and promote global justice, covering topics such as genocide, war crimes, and human trafficking.
• Globalization and its Challenges: This unit examines the economic, political, and social impacts of globalization, including the growing divide between the rich and the poor, cultural homogenization, and environmental degradation.
• Terrorism and Political Violence: This unit analyzes the various forms of political violence, including terrorism, guerrilla warfare, and state terror, and explores the root causes and potential solutions to these threats.
• Political Economy of Development: This unit studies the relationship between politics and economic development, examining the role of government, multinational corporations, and international financial institutions in shaping the global economy.
• Global Environmental Politics: This unit explores the political dimensions of environmental issues, including climate change, deforestation, and biodiversity loss, and analyzes the policies and strategies needed to address these challenges.
• Religion and Politics: This unit examines the complex relationship between religion and politics, exploring the ways in which religious beliefs and practices shape political ideologies and institutions, and how political systems influence religious expression and freedom.
• Gender and Politics: This unit analyzes the role of gender in politics, examining the ways in which gender inequality is perpetuated and challenged in political systems, and exploring the strategies and policies needed to promote gender equality and empower women.
